Guest   Wed Dec 05, 2007 8:31 am GMT
I think
Galician, Catalan and Brazilian portuguese

European Portuguese and Italian grammar are a bit trickier than the spanish one

European Portuguese has some more verbal tenses and the use of personal pronounce is harder than in Spanish
Italian uses two verbs to form all the compound tenses and the use of articles and prepositions is more irreguliar and trickier than in Spanish
